So I've got a weird problem.
When I open the Task Manager on my surface pro 4, apart from it taking 20 seconds to actually display something (white screen in the interim), it makes my trackpad very errr... crazy..
It basically unusable. It's much much slower than it normally is and it's very hard to navigate with it unless scrolling very very very slow.
Close task manager and it's back to normal.
This only happens in when on battery. Plugged in, task manager opens quick and trackpad is responsive as ever. Anyone else have a similar problem?
This is a clean install of AU via iso and updated to .51
